The global market for Orchard Tractors was valued at US$12.2 Billion in 2024 and is projected to reach US$14.0 Billion by 2030, growing at a CAGR of 2.3% from 2024 to 2030. Why Are Orchard Tractors Gaining Importance in Precision Farming and Fruit Production?
Orchard tractors are specialized agricultural vehicles tailored to operate efficiently within fruit orchards and vineyards, where maneuverability, compact dimensions, and crop-safe designs are paramount. Unlike general-purpose tractors, orchard variants are engineered with narrow widths, low profiles, enclosed cabs, and rounded fenders to navigate tight row spacings without damaging tree canopies or crops. As high-value perennial crops such as apples, citrus, grapes, olives, and nuts demand greater precision in cultivation and harvesting, orchard tractors have emerged as indispensable equipment for enhancing productivity and orchard longevity.The expansion of commercial fruit orchards globally, driven by rising consumer demand for fresh produce and fruit-based exports, is spurring the uptake of orchard-specific machinery. Modern orchard operations require multipurpose tractors capable of powering sprayers, mowers, tillers, pruners, and loaders across variable terrains and seasonal workloads. The integration of power take-off (PTO), hydraulic systems, and four-wheel drive capabilities in compact configurations is enabling orchard tractors to perform diverse operations while minimizing soil compaction and tree injury.
Growers are increasingly prioritizing orchard mechanization due to growing labor shortages, stricter farm safety norms, and the need to maintain consistent yields. Orchard tractors play a central role in minimizing manual intervention during critical periods such as spraying, fertilizing, pruning, and harvesting. With orchards being long-term investments spanning decades, the precision and adaptability of tractors directly impact profitability and sustainability of fruit production systems.
What Are the Technological Innovations Transforming Orchard Tractor Capabilities?
The orchard tractor segment is undergoing a technology-driven transformation, incorporating digital farming tools, smart hydraulics, and automation features to meet the evolving needs of modern horticulture. Precision agriculture systems-including GPS guidance, variable rate application (VRA), and geofencing-are being integrated into orchard tractors to optimize input usage and reduce operational errors. These capabilities are particularly beneficial in tasks such as pesticide spraying and nutrient application, where accuracy is crucial for both efficacy and regulatory compliance.Electric and hybrid orchard tractors are emerging as game-changers, offering low-noise, zero-emission solutions tailored for sustainable orcharding practices. Companies are developing battery-powered tractors suitable for small to mid-sized orchards, especially in Europe and California, where emissions regulations and environmental certifications are stringent. These electric models also offer smoother torque control and lower maintenance needs, improving uptime and total cost of ownership.
Advanced operator ergonomics and telematics are improving user experience and productivity. Climate-controlled cabs, joystick-based controls, and vibration-reducing suspensions are enhancing operator comfort during long work hours. Meanwhile, IoT-enabled tractors allow real-time data tracking on engine performance, task completion, and predictive maintenance. Remote diagnostics, fleet management dashboards, and integration with orchard management software are empowering growers to monitor and optimize tractor usage as part of a broader digital farming ecosystem.
Which Regional Trends and End-Use Segments Are Fueling Demand Momentum?
Europe and North America currently lead the orchard tractor market, owing to the maturity of commercial horticulture, high mechanization levels, and presence of established manufacturers. Italy, France, Spain, and Germany are prominent adopters of compact vineyard and orchard tractors, with strong demand in the grape and apple sectors. In North America, California, Washington, and Oregon remain key hubs for orchard tractor usage in almond, citrus, and stone fruit production. Local emissions regulations and subsidy programs are accelerating the transition toward low-emission orchard equipment.Asia-Pacific is witnessing rapid orchard expansion and mechanization, particularly in China, India, and Australia. China, the world’s largest producer of apples and citrus fruits, is investing in rural mechanization programs to modernize fragmented orchards and improve productivity. In India, increasing government support for horticulture under the Rashtriya Krishi Vikas Yojana (RKVY) and horticulture-specific equipment subsidies are stimulating demand for affordable orchard tractor models tailored for smallholders. Australia's growing export-oriented fruit industry and water-efficient farming mandates are encouraging the adoption of precision tractors.
Smaller orchard owners, cooperatives, and large agribusinesses alike are investing in multi-functional orchard tractors to streamline year-round operations. Tractors with modular attachments-such as rotary mulchers, rear-mounted sprayers, and in-row weeders-are especially popular. Rental markets are also gaining traction, with equipment-sharing platforms enabling seasonal access to orchard machinery without capital expenditure.
What Factors Are Driving Market Expansion and Long-Term Investment in Orchard Tractors?
The growth in the global orchard tractors market is driven by increasing fruit production, expanding high-value horticulture, precision farming adoption, and mechanization of labor-intensive orchard operations. As global consumption of fresh fruits, juices, dried fruits, and plant-based snacks rises, orchard productivity and efficiency become vital. Orchard tractors enable growers to reduce dependence on seasonal labor, standardize operations, and comply with agrochemical safety standards-all of which are essential for export certification and profit margins.Sustainability imperatives are pushing manufacturers to develop low-emission and soil-conserving orchard machinery. The introduction of electric and hybrid models is not only reducing carbon footprints but also improving compatibility with organic and environmentally certified farming systems. Government incentives-such as EU’s CAP subsidies, USDA equipment grants, and state-level horticulture schemes-are supporting orchard modernization through subsidized machinery purchases and technology trials.
Companies like New Holland, Kubota, Fendt (AGCO), John Deere, Antonio Carraro, and Carraro Tractors are leading the charge with increasingly specialized product lines, digital integration, and service networks tailored for orchard applications. The convergence of compact design, automation, and sustainable performance is enabling orchard tractors to serve as both productivity enablers and strategic investments in the global horticulture value chain.
